British Palestinian rapper Shadia Mansour, for example, has insisted the keffiyeh's symbolic attachment to Palestinian identity must be recognised and remembered and has made references to the scarf in her work. She released her first single Al-Kufiyyeh 3arabeyyeh, meaning The Keffiyeh is Arab, in 2010 as an ode to the garment and to her identity. In Jordan and Saudi Arabia, which are still controlled by Bedouins (albeit of different clans), kaffiyehs remain the standard to this day. In Arabia for example, a shemagh (as they call their kaffiyehs) is mandatory when visiting government offices and when attending formal events.

While all the ensuing controversy helped to increase the popularity of the scarf, it sounded the death knell for the factories in Hebron, which couldn’t compete with a flood of cheap copies. Having saturated the market, the foreign copies even reached Jerusalem, only 28 kilometres away.
